The long wait to buy legal cannabis in Kelowna is nearly over.
Nine months after the feds legalized the cultivation, sale and consumption of cannabis, Kelowna finally has its first legal retail store.
The province has issued a licence to Hobo Recreational Cannabis.
Company director Harrison Stoker says his company learned over the last few days it has been successful in obtaining a provincial licence, and hopes to open to the public Wednesday or Thursday.
